Understanding Cataract Surgical Treatment Process



Checking out the steps associated with cataract surgical procedure can help reduce any anxiousness or uncertainty you might have regarding the treatment. Cataract surgery is an usual and extremely effective procedure that involves eliminating the gloomy lens in your eye and replacing it with a clear synthetic lens.

Prior to the surgery, your eye will certainly be numbed with eye drops or a shot to guarantee you do not really feel any discomfort during the procedure. The surgeon will certainly make a little cut in your eye to access the cataract and break it up making use of ultrasound waves prior to meticulously removing it.

As soon as the cataract is eliminated, the man-made lens will be placed in its place. The whole surgical procedure normally takes about 15-30 mins per eye and is usually done one eye at once.

After the surgery, you may experience some light pain or obscured vision, yet this is regular and should enhance as your eye heals.

Post-Operative Treatment Tips



After cataract surgical procedure, offering correct post-operative care is vital for your loved one's recovery. Guarantee they put on the safety guard over their eye as advised by the medical professional. Help them carry out suggested eye drops and medicines on schedule to stop infection and help healing.

Encourage your loved one to avoid touching or massaging their eyes, as this can result in difficulties. Assist them in adhering to any constraints on bending, lifting hefty items, or joining laborious tasks to stop strain on the eyes. See to it they participate in all follow-up appointments with the eye medical professional for keeping track of development.



Maintain the eye area clean and completely dry, avoiding water or soap directly in the eyes. Urge your liked one to put on sunglasses to safeguard their eyes from intense light and glare throughout the healing process. Be patient and encouraging as they recover, providing assistance with day-to-day tasks as needed.
